ORA-16052: DB_UNIQUE_NAME attribute is required

Cause: The DB_UNIQUE_NAME attribute is required when
DG_CONFIG is enabled.
Action: Use the DB_UNIQUE_NAME attribute to specify a valid
Data Guard Name for the destination. The list of valid
DB_UNIQUE_NAMEs can be seen with the V$DATAGUARD_CONFIG view.
